thinkphp5翻页参数失效的解决方法

以前用的thinkphp3.X翻页的写法可能不能适用thinkphp5,翻页做了一些调整,下面就不多说直接上示例代码

$data = Db::name('table')->where($map)->order('timestamp')->paginate(20,false,['query'=>request()->param()]);
$page = $data->render();
$this->assign('page', $page);

paginate后面的第二个参数和第三个参数这样加进去即可,这样是只是get类型的翻页,如果只是post过来的翻页还没测试过,只不过翻页还是建议get方式比较好

内容版权声明:除非注明,否则皆为本站原创文章。

转载注明出处:http://sulao.cn/post/546.html

我要评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。